Product Overview: SN74CBT6845CDWR
The SN74CBT6845CDWR is a high-performance integrated circuit designed by the renowned semiconductor manufacturer, Texas Instruments. This device belongs to a category of switches known as 10-bit FET bus switches. The product is specifically engineered to provide high-speed switching capabilities with low on-state resistance, making it an ideal choice for bus exchange applications in data processing and telecommunications systems.
Key Features
- Bus Switch Type: 10-bit FET
- Package: The device comes in a 24-pin SOP (Small Outline Package) with a wide body, denoted by the suffix 'DW' in the part number, which provides a compact footprint while allowing for efficient thermal dissipation and ease of soldering onto PCBs.
- Logic Level: It operates with a 5V logic level, making it compatible with a wide range of digital circuits.
- Low On-State Resistance: This switch offers a low on-state resistance, typically around 5 ohms, which minimizes signal distortion and power loss.
- Bi-Directional Data Flow: The SN74CBT6845CDWR supports bi-directional data flow, making it versatile for bidirectional bus applications.
- Quick Switching: With its fast switching speed, the device ensures minimal propagation delay, which is critical for high-speed data transmission.
- Power-Down Protection: The switch has power-down protection on all data ports, which helps to prevent damage to the device during power-off scenarios.
Applications
Due to its robust design and high-speed characteristics, the SN74CBT6845CDWR is suitable for various applications, including:
- Bus isolation and switching in servers and routers
- Memory switching in computing systems
- Signal gating in data communication equipment
- Interface switching in peripherals and consumer electronics
